The Economics of Opium: A Public Dialogue on the Narcotics Economy in Afghanistan

OTTAWA, June 27 /CNW Telbec/ – Two leading experts on the narcotics economy of Afghanistan will be in Ottawa on June 28 for a public dialogue aimed at promoting understanding of the challenges posed by the illicit cultivation of poppy and its impact on the reconstruction and development of Afghanistan.

Lucy van Oldenbarneveld of CBC News at Six will moderate the dialogue, which is organized by Aga Khan Foundation Canada and the International Development Research Centre. For more information, visit: http://www.idrc.ca/events-opium
